These rankings show the most affordable colleges for Family and Consumer Sciences/Human Sciences majors who live in Rhode Island.
Rankings are calculated by estimating the net price at every college offering Family and Consumer Sciences/Human Sciences degrees for a "typical" middle class family living in the state of Rhode Island.
Note: Net price is the actual cost of college paid after factoring in financial aid.The net prices displayed in these rankings are College Raptor's estimates.
